The values of the following properties displayed in the title can be transferred from the model document to the drawing:

Designation (simple – completely, compound – all parts, except the document code),

Name,

Mass:

Material (only for part drawings; if a stock part is used in the part, then You can enable indication of a blank instead of material),

Developed by, Checked by, Approved by, In-process inspection, Compliance assessment.

This information is entered in the model document — part (*.m3d) or assembly (*.a3d) — when setting its properties.

Property values are only transferred if they are defined in the model.

It is also possible to display the values of other model properties, both system and library properties, in the drawing title. To do this, you must edit the title included in the drawing design by linking its cells to the required properties. Read more...

By default, the transfer of property values from the model to the drawing is performed when the first associative view is created — the Link to model properties switch in the view parameters is in position I (on), see Transfer properties when creating a view. The values of the transferred properties are displayed in the title.

In furtherance of editing the title, you can manually change the contents of its fields transferred from the model. This will change the values of the corresponding drawing properties. These properties will lose their connection with the model.

In the main caption editing mode, you can also change the set of properties to be transferred and select another model for transfer (if the drawing contains associative views from different models).  You can also refuse  to  transfer properties from the model by setting the Link with model properties switch to 0 (disabled).  This switch is located in the Drawing properties section of  the Parameters panel.

Fields that do not receive information from the model are filled in manually. This is done in the same way as in a normal drawing.

Setting the mass display

In the mode of editing the title of an associative drawing, you can customize the mass display settings. The elements of the Mass format group, located in the Drawing properties section of the Parameters panel, are used for this purpose.

A group is present in the Parameters panel if the following conditions are met:

The Link to model properties switch is set to I (on),

in the list of drawing properties in the line Mass, the Source option is enabled.

Description of the elements of the Mass format group is given in the table.

Mass display controls


Name

Description


Number of decimal places

Field for entering or selecting the number of decimal places in the mass value.


Mass units

This list is used to select measurement units to display the value of the model mass in the title block: kilograms, grams or tons.


Abbreviation

A field to enter designations of mass units. Symbols entered in this field are transferred to the Mass column.
